Best Tricks to Master C, C++, Python for Students Your complete roadmap to programming excellence. Whether you're preparing for university exams, technical interviews, or building real-world projects, mastering C, C++, and Python opens doors to countless opportunities in software development, data science, and beyond.
Why Learn These Three Programming Languages? Foundation & Performance Modern Development Career Advantages C and C++ provide deep understanding of computer architecture, memory management, and system-level programming. These low-level languages are essential for operating systems, embedded systems, and performance-critical applications. Python dominates modern programming with its versatility in web development, data science, artificial intelligence, and automation. Its readable syntax makes it perfect for beginners whilst remaining powerful for advanced applications. Companies actively seek developers proficient in multiple languages. Combining C/C++ expertise with Python skills makes you invaluable for roles spanning from systems programming to machine learning engineering.
Starting with C Programming: Building Blocks 01 02 Master Syntax Fundamentals Conquer Pointers Early Begin with variables, data types, operators, and control structures. Write simple programmes daily to build muscle memory. Focus on understanding compilation process and how C interacts with hardware. Pointers are C's superpower but often intimidate beginners. Practise pointer arithmetic, dereferencing, and memory addresses through hands-on exercises. Use visualisation tools to understand memory layout. 03 04 Implement Data Structures Debug Like a Professional Code arrays, linked lists, stacks, and queues from scratch. Understanding how data structures work at memory level gives you deep comprehension that higher-level languages abstract away. Learn GDB debugger and valgrind for memory leak detection. Reading compiler warnings and error messages carefully develops problem-solving skills essential for any programmer.
Elevating Skills with C++ Programming Object-Oriented Programming Templates & STL Transition from procedural C to OOP concepts. Master classes, objects, inheritance, polymorphism, and encapsulation through real-world projects like building a library management system. Standard Template Library accelerates development dramatically. Learn vectors, maps, sets, and algorithms. Templates enable writing generic, reusable code that works with multiple data types. Performance Optimisation C++ offers fine-grained control over performance. Study move semantics, RAII pattern, smart pointers, and const correctness. Profile code to identify bottlenecks using tools like gprof.
Python Programming: Rapid Development Mastery Pythonic Code Principles Essential Libraries Automation & Scripting Learn list comprehensions, generators, decorators, and context managers. Write code that's not just functional but elegant. Follow PEP 8 style guidelines for professional-quality programmes. Explore NumPy for numerical computing, Pandas for data manipulation, Matplotlib for visualisation, and Flask/Django for web development. Libraries extend Python's capabilities exponentially. Python excels at automating repetitive tasks. Create scripts for file management, web scraping, API interactions, and data processing. This practical skill saves countless hours professionally.
Proven Learning Strategies That Work Project-Based Learning Daily Coding Practice Theory alone won't make you proficient. Build progressively complex projects: start with calculators, move to games, then create web applications. Each project reinforces concepts whilst building portfolio pieces. Consistency trumps intensity. Solve problems on platforms like LeetCode, HackerRank, and CodeChef daily. Even 30 minutes daily yields better results than weekend marathons. Read Quality Code Collaborate & Review Study open-source projects on GitHub. Reading professional code teaches best practices, design patterns, and problem-solving approaches you won't find in tutorials. Join coding communities, participate in code reviews, and pair programme with peers. Explaining concepts to others deepens your understanding whilst learning from their perspectives.
Common Mistakes Students Must Avoid Tutorial Hell Trap Watching endless tutorials without coding creates false confidence. After learning a concept, immediately apply it. Build something, break it, fix it. Active coding beats passive watching. Skipping Fundamentals Jumping to frameworks before mastering basics creates shaky foundations. Thoroughly understand variables, loops, functions, and data structures before tackling advanced topics. Not Reading Documentation Official documentation is your best learning resource. Develop the habit of reading language references and library docs. This skill proves invaluable throughout your career. Fear of Errors Errors are learning opportunities, not failures. Each bug teaches something new. Embrace debugging as skill development rather than setback. The best programmers make mistakes constantly. Neglecting Version Control Learn Git from day one. Version control isn't just for teams; it's essential for managing your own projects, tracking changes, and building professional habits employers value.
Exam Preparation & Technical Interview Success Master Core Concepts For exams, focus on language syntax, data structures, algorithms, and time complexity. Create summary notes and flashcards. Practise writing code by hand to prepare for written exams. 1 Mock Interview Practice Technical interviews test problem-solving under pressure. Use platforms like Pramp for mock interviews. Practise explaining your thought process aloud whilst coding—communication matters as much as code. 2 System Design Basics For advanced positions, understand system architecture fundamentals. Learn how to design scalable applications, database schemas, and API structures. This knowledge distinguishes junior from mid-level developers. 3
Essential Resources for Continuous Learning Online Learning Platforms Must-Read Programming Books Coursera, Udemy, and edX offer structured courses from universities. Free resources include freeCodeCamp, The Odin Project, and MIT OpenCourseWare. Supplement with YouTube channels like Corey Schafer and Derek Banas. "The C Programming Language" by Kernighan & Ritchie, "Effective C++" by Scott Meyers, and "Python Crash Course" by Eric Matthes are industry standards. "Clean Code" by Robert Martin applies to all languages. Developer Communities Professional Certifications Stack Overflow for problem-solving, Reddit's r/learnprogramming for guidance, and Discord servers for real-time help. Attend local meetups and hackathons to network with fellow developers. Consider certifications like Python Institute's PCAP, C++ Institute's CPA, or platform-specific credentials. Whilst not mandatory, certifications validate skills and strengthen CVs for entry-level positions.
